# Environments: PinPoint Autocomplete

Three environments: dev, staging, prod. Dev resets nightly. Staging mirrors prod data minus the Harwick dataset. Promotions go dev → staging → prod; no direct prod pushes. Staging smoke tests must pass before release sign-off. Prod config is locked behind change review. Current staging values are as follows.

settings of kafop-fahog:
PRAWYN_PIN=8793
PRAWYN_METRICS_HOST=metrics.prawyn.lumiccorp.corp
PRAWYN_LOG_LEVEL=warn
PRAWYN_TENANT=kasox

## Big-Deal Discounts (Managers Only)

Sales leads: anything over 200 seats of Quillbase can now get up to 18% off without escalation. Beyond that, loop in Marta before quoting — no exceptions, we've been burned. Stack nothing on top of partner rebates. The reasoning behind the new ceiling is spelled out in the note below.

confidential, kagep-kahof: Druokax Systems plans to lower the Ulaath list price by 53 percent in March.

## Design excerpt: Queuewright autoscaler

Welcome aboard! The short version: Queuewright watches queue depth per shard and scales workers up when the backlog outpaces drain rate. We deliberately scale up fast and down slow — flapping costs more than a few idle workers. New folks often ask why we don't key off CPU; the answer is that our jobs are IO-bound and CPU lies to you. Everything is driven by a handful of knobs, shown here.

limits module of tafop-fawef:
PRIORITIES = {
    "eliiel": 453,
    "sormir": 605,
}

## Approvals: StageView Seat-Map Renderer

All changes to the StageView renderer used by the Ellermont Playhouse booking flow require security review before release. Pay particular attention to the SVG sanitisation layer and the venue-config parser, as both handle externally supplied layout files. Final approval authority for renderer releases rests with the designated owner.

named custodian: Brivan Eliath Quenox Frador